Single-Use Flower Petal Soaps

Learn to make some pretty single-use soaps for your guests!

Instructions:

dip petal_21. Melt your soap base in the microwave (see Melt & Pour Soap Instructions), add your fragrance, and colorant if desired. While your soap is melting, prepare your flower petals. If you are using fabric flowers, cut the individual petals off using scissors.

2. Using something such as tweezers, dip the petals into the melted soap base. Allow most of the excess  soap to drip off of the petal, and then lay the petal on a cookie sheet to cool. Repeat the process until you have your desired amount of petal soaps.

3. Once the petals are completely cool, remove them from the  cookie sheet and place the soaps in something such as a decorative basket next to the sink for your guests.

These petal soaps are perfect for get-togethers. Each petal can be used to scrub the grime off of dirty hands, and can be discarded after use, so that each guest can use their own personal soap. Plus, they add beauty to any bathroom decor.
